The Dow Jumped After the Fed Minutes — and What Else Happened in the Stock Market Today
The stock market jumped higher Wednesday after the Federal Reserve’s minutes revealed that the central bank is sticking to its commitment to lift short-term interest rates, but that isn’t getting any more aggressive on tightening monetary policy. The Fed’s minutes acknowledged that there will be “ongoing increases” in the federal-funds rate going forward to combat high inflation by lowering economic demand. The Fed sees half-percentage point increases to the fed-funds rate—rather than quarter-point hikes—as likely in the next couple of meetings.
